I suppose that you are still using Keleey DS1 for recordings.
Or at least your Satchurator is very similar designed to that distortion pedal.
You can (ask someone to) do a simple mod for improving volume control. JSX is high gain amp, so you are probably using DS1 just as a booster. Therefore it is a bit tricky to get sweet spot.
You can replace Volume pot 100KB (linear) with 82K Metal Film resistor in series with 22KA (Logarithmic).
Or 68K metal film with 33K log pot (unusual value for pot though)
In this way you can get fine tuning in desired area, and all that without changing tonal characteristic.
I did the same and it is perfect booster for SLO and X88r.
